Transaction 9d4d74a40f93493f72019567c9d2932a180c7ca4873bb0aa3a5e201e37360596

block
66e078daa42e78836ea20d0027ab4cc4ec9d5a8e944ac7c1158289820b2a528d

1 Input

27 Outputs